The Pallet Rack Upright Frame S645-B25 from Gebrüder Schulte with a height of 5000 mm and a depth of 1100 mm is a robust and flexible solution for setting up pallet rack systems.
The height adjustment of the beams in the 50 mm grid allows precise adaptation to your specific storage requirements. This allows you to efficiently use the available storage space and optimally organize your goods.
The frame is delivered disassembled, which facilitates transport and assembly. It consists of 2 supports, the C-frame, 2 base plates, 4 floor anchors and 2 shims (2 mm). The blue powder-coated uprights and the galvanized frame offer robust protection against corrosion and ensure a long service life.
Important note on load capacity: The exact load capacity of the upright frame depends on various factors such as the beam used, the buckling height and the place of use. For precise planning and advice, please contact our team of experts.
